Understanding Your Internet Needs in Syracuse, Indiana
Before diving into specific providers, it's important to assess your internet needs. Consider the following factors:
- Number of Users: How many people in your household will be using the internet simultaneously?
- Online Activities: What types of activities will you be doing online? (e.g., streaming, gaming, video conferencing, basic browsing)
- Data Usage: How much data do you typically use each month?
- Budget: How much are you willing to spend on internet service?
Answering these questions will help you determine the appropriate internet speed and data allowance for your household. For example, a single user who primarily browses the web may only need a basic internet plan, while a family of four who streams videos and plays online games will require a faster, more robust connection.
Major Internet Providers in Syracuse, Indiana
Syracuse, Indiana, is served by a variety of internet providers, each offering different technologies, speeds, and pricing. Here's a look at some of the major players:
- Xfinity (Comcast): Offers cable internet service with a wide range of speed options.
- CenturyLink: Provides DSL and fiber internet service, depending on location.
- T-Mobile Home Internet: Wireless internet provider, covering many locations.
- Verizon 5G Home Internet: Wireless internet provider, coverage is still expanding.
- Satellite Internet (HughesNet, Viasat): Available throughout Syracuse, but often comes with higher latency and data caps.

Fastest Internet Provider in Syracuse, Indiana
For the fastest internet speeds in Syracuse, Indiana, you'll likely want to consider Xfinity or CenturyLink's fiber options (if available in your specific location). Xfinity's cable internet can deliver impressive speeds, while CenturyLink's fiber service offers symmetrical speeds, meaning upload and download speeds are the same. Fiber is generally considered the most reliable and future-proof internet technology.

FAQ 3: What is the difference between DSL and cable internet?
DSL internet uses existing phone lines to transmit data, while cable internet uses coaxial cables. Cable internet typically offers faster speeds than DSL, but DSL can be more widely available in some areas.
FAQ 4: What is a good internet speed for working from home?
For working from home, a download speed of at least 25 Mbps is generally recommended. If you frequently participate in video conferences or upload large files, you may want to consider a plan with faster speeds, such as 50 Mbps or higher.

Beyond Speed and Price: Other Factors to Consider
While speed and price are important, several other factors can influence your choice of internet provider in Syracuse, Indiana. These include:
- Data Caps: Some internet plans have data caps, which limit the amount of data you can use each month. If you exceed your data cap, you may be charged extra fees or have your internet speed throttled. Make sure to choose a plan with a data cap that meets your needs.
- Contract Length: Some internet providers require you to sign a contract for a specific period (e.g., 12 months, 24 months). If you cancel your service before the end of the contract, you may be charged an early termination fee.
- Customer Service: Read online reviews to get a sense of the quality of customer service provided by different internet providers. A provider with responsive and helpful customer service can be invaluable if you experience technical issues or have questions about your bill.
- Bundling Options: Some internet providers offer bundled services, such as internet, TV, and phone. Bundling can save you money compared to purchasing these services separately, but make sure to compare the total cost of the bundle to the cost of purchasing each service individually.
- Equipment Fees: Many internet providers charge a monthly fee for the modem and router. You may be able to save money by purchasing your own equipment, but make sure it's compatible with the provider's network.
